Output 2ad752592113bba46c9b3d350a7b377a27e8d6cdf618e35cb791d7c97669c4ae:0

value
3074000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a34ffd46b80ff66eff677b0a31a79ab15fde40d OP_EQUAL
address
M8q8UokVFM1SAQgqLLYdnNxrWwq8qX2W5e
transaction
2ad752592113bba46c9b3d350a7b377a27e8d6cdf618e35cb791d7c97669c4ae
spent
true